* Andrew Vasquez (andrew.vasquez@qlogic.com) wrote:
> On Wed, 02 Nov 2005, Ashutosh Naik wrote:
> 
> > This patch fixes the fact that although the scsi_transport_fc.h header
> > file is not included in qla_def.h, we still reference the function
> > fc_remote_port_unlock in the qlogic  ISP2x00 device driver ,
> > qla2xxx/qla_rscn.c
> 
> Perhaps for the stable tree (2.6.14.x) this fix is appropriate.  The
> scsi-misc-2.6.git tree already has codes which address this issue.

It's preferable to have that fix pending in scsi-misc for -stable.
